Limited edition prints

A limited edition print is an original image limited to a predetermined quantity to retain its integrity and value. The edition is individually signed and numbered by the artist. The numbers denote the individual piece number in the edition over the total edition size.

In addition to the numbered prints in an edition, there are usually an additional 20-25% of signed proofs produced for the artist and publisher. Artist's Proofs (APB) are reserved for the artist and are used for personal use. They are not part of the regular edition. Printer's Proofs (PB) are proofs presented to the printer upon completion of printing.

A Certificate of Authenticity accompanies each limited edition you purchase. This certifies that your print is an authentic limited edition print. The certificate should detail the exact number of numbered prints, Artist's Proofs, Printer's Proofs, and Sales Proofs created. The studio where the print was produced, the type of paper used, the number of colour plates, the date the edition was signed, and the date the plates were cancelled are also mentioned.
